Forbidden Planet International
We found 1 locations in Cambridgeshire, GB. See the list below, sorted by city.
Forbidden Planet
60 Burleigh Street
Cambridge, Cambridgeshire CB1 1DJ
United Kingdom
We found 1 locations in Cambridgeshire, GB. See the list below, sorted by city.
60 Burleigh Street
Cambridge, Cambridgeshire CB1 1DJ
United Kingdom